Transaction 1173b30fa1432f10618548055972bfa5ede25c686c76af79afbb9cb8ea7ff506
1 Input
2 Outputs
- 1173b30fa1432f10618548055972bfa5ede25c686c76af79afbb9cb8ea7ff506:0
- 1173b30fa1432f10618548055972bfa5ede25c686c76af79afbb9cb8ea7ff506:1
value 687143
address 12Fn2B1MiAuW41oMDas2DSmcShuSZqrk4X
value 10822900
address 1N4Ws6xkefHNbxy8S1Z2FQajY1PqkxZabe